Software Development

We have extensive experience in all phases of software development including:

We use an agile methodology that ensures rapid response to evolving requirements. Once we meet with you to determine your requirements, we develop the best overall design to meet your needs both now, and as you grow. Using our proven methodology we have developed numerous stable custom software solutions, some of which are over 20 years old and are still in active use today.


Is it time to migrate your legacy computer software to a more modern technology platform? Today’s security requirements, as wells as the tools available to address security concerns, are much more sophisticated than they were even 10 years ago. If you have custom or proprietary software product in need of modernization, we can help.


Information is power. What could your data be telling you if only it knew how? Our reporting solutions can give you access to the insights you crave from your valuable data, putting what you wish for at your fingertips.